Confidentiality Issues Mushroom in the Tribune Bankruptcy

March 17, 2010

The Tribune Co. bankruptcy, which has already seen its share of dustups over such diverse matters as fee examiners and Sidley Austin's proposed rates, has generated yet another twist, according to court records: possible sanctions against a bondholder after its law firm, Brown Rudnick, mistakenly included confidential papers in a public filing. The Brown Rudnick mistake, and the possible repercussions for the firm's client, are only a small piece of a larger confidentiality battle looming in the Tribune bankruptcy.
